Jacksonville Man Arrested in Elder Abuse Case


A Jacksonville man has been charged with purchasing cruises and other items using money that belonged to an elderly victim.
Lonnie Jerome Jarvis, 42, of Holly Shelter Road, was charged Friday by the Onslow County Sheriff's Department with exploitation of an elder adult.
The Onslow County Sheriff's Office began investigating after receiving a report from Adult Protective Services Dec. 29,
"The investigation showed that Jarvis had been handling the victim's money for the past few years and during that time the bills had not been paid on time with utility services being suspended. An initial review of the victim's bank statements indicated that Jarvis was withdrawing large sums of money using an ATM card," according to a press release from the Sheriff's Department.
Jarvis is accused of using almost $150,000 of the victim's money on cruises, personal and dating sites and personal purchases, according to the Sheriff's Department.
"It was verified that the victim's water service, electric service and cable service had been disconnected several times for non-payment," according to the release.
Bond was set at $50,000.
